TISHA B’AV SERVICES

On Saturday night, August 9 at 8:00 pm, hear chanting by candlelight of the Book of Lamentations, and readings commemorating the destruction of the Temples.  Join us on Sunday, August 10 at 9:10 am without t’fillin and 6:00 pm for Mincha service with t’fillin.
